The Southern Branch of the Irish Patchwork Society is an active group of quilters who meet on a monthly basis for talks, demonstrations, workshops and to socialise with like-minded quilters. During periods of social restrictions we meet virtually, keep an eye on your emails…!
Contact us: corkips “at” gmail.com
Meetings take place (usually) on the second Saturday of each month (except July and August) in the hall of the Sacred Heart Church, Western Road, Cork from 10:00 to 12:30.
Fees at the door:
Members: €4
Non-members: €8 (please note: Non-members may attend two meetings as non-members, after that we ask you to take out annual membership)
